LAKELAND, Fla. (October 10, 2020) - St. Thomas University (STU) Women's Soccer (4-2, 3-2 TSC) fell in the Sun Conference Match of the Week to the Southeastern University Fire (7-0, 5-0 TSC), 5-1 on Saturday afternoon.

Game Notes
- The Bobcats were able to strike first in the Sun Conference Match of the Week, as Manzur scored her second goal of the season to give STU a 1-0 lead in the fourth minute.
- Ferradaz set up the Manzur goal by intercepting a Fire pass, as Manzur finished the opportunity.Â
- St. Thomas remained on the offensive, with Weide and Ferradaz each taking a shot. However, neither found the back of the net.Â
- SEU tied the match in the eighth minute, 1-1.
- Manzur took her second shot on goal in the first half, but this time the attempt was saved.
- Southeastern took the lead in the 32nd minute.
- St. Thomas couldn't muster another shot for the rest of the first half and went into the second half trailing Southeastern, 2-1.Â
- SEU began to pull away in the first 15-minutes of the second half, scoring their third goal of the match.Â
- In the 62nd minute, the Fire added another goal and took a 4-1 lead over STU.Â
- Southeastern scored their fifth goal of the match in the 71st minute, scoring on a penalty shot.
- STU couldn't capitalize in the second half and went without scoring, falling to the Fire, 5-1.Â
